> > I added a drop rule for icmp to my broadcast address in my zyxels filter
> > set, but this is not a default rule.
> > Isn't there a way to solve that problem on the isp level?
>
> ISPs could simply null route the broadcast address of all their ADSL
> customer with a fix ip range.
> In this case the router nor the customer will reply.
>
> If they use a Cisco as LNS they could simply add this in their radius
server
>
> Cisco-AVpair="lcp:interface-config=ip address <broadcast_ip>
255.255.255.255
> secondary\n"
>
> That will add a 2nd IP on the Virtual-Access interface and block the
> broadcast @ the ISP side.
> In this case the router will reply once.
